The equation of the line passing through the points (3,1), (6,2), and (9,3) can be found by calculating the slope (m) using the equation m =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1). Taking the points (3,1) and (6,2), we get m = (2 - 1)/(6 - 3) = 1/3.
Therefore, the equation of the line y=mx through the origin is y = (1/3)x.
